Contractor Services in Ermelo, Mpumalanga
Contractor services in Ermelo, Mpumalanga, cover a broad range of responsibilities aimed at maintaining, repairing and upgrading buildings and infrastructure within the local community. These professionals are typically engaged to deliver practical, hands‑on solutions across domestic, commercial and light industrial settings. The aim is to ensure that projects are completed safely, efficiently and in compliance with local regulations and best practices.
In residential contexts, clients commonly seek skilled contractors for activities such as minor and major repairs, renovations, extensions, roofing repairs, plumbing and electrical work, flooring, plastering, painting and decorating, as well as carpentry and fencing. The emphasis is on durability, suitability to the climatic conditions of Mpumalanga, and the ability to operate within the available budget. Homes in and around Ermelo may require contractors who can adapt to the region’s climate, which features warm summers and cooler winters, as well as the logistics of rural access and resource availability.
Commercial and light industrial projects typically involve more planned and coordinated undertakings. This includes project management for refurbishments, interior fit-outs, electrical and mechanical services, roof replacements, and targeted maintenance programmes designed to minimise downtime. Contractors in Ermelo are often expected to liaise with property owners, facility managers and local authorities to arrange access, inspections and compliance checks. The scope of work tends to emphasise reliability, adherence to timelines and effective communication throughout the project lifecycle.
Any prospective client can expect a formal approach to assessment and quotation. Before any work begins, a contractor will usually conduct a site visit to understand the specific needs, confirm measurements and evaluate potential risks. This helps in delivering a clear estimate that accounts for labour, materials, contingencies and any required permits. Depending on the project, there may be phased work schedules, with milestones to monitor progress and quality. Inspections during and after completion help to verify workmanship and compliance with safety standards.
Practical considerations for engaging a contractor in Ermelo include assessing access routes, material supply timelines, and the impact of weather on progress. The local environment may influence material choices; for example, weather‑resistant finishes or termite‑resistant timber can be important in certain properties. Proximity matters as well, with nearby suppliers and workshops potentially reducing lead times and transportation costs. Clients are encouraged to discuss subcontracting arrangements, where applicable, and to obtain documentation that detail warranties, maintenance expectations and the handling of any defects discovered after completion.
Health and safety form an integral part of the contractor’s duties. This encompasses the use of appropriate personal protective equipment, secure scaffolding or access equipment where required, risk assessments, and the implementation of site housekeeping practices. In Ermelo, adherence to municipal bylaws and building regulations is fundamental, as is the obligation to obtain any necessary approvals or permits before commencing certain works. Communication is pivotal, with clear notification of planned works, potential disruption, and expected timelines helping to manage expectations among tenants, neighbours and property owners.
Overall, contractor services in Ermelo provide a practical, on‑the‑ground solution for a range of building needs. Clients can anticipate a focus on quality workmanship, transparent pricing up front, and recommendations that reflect local conditions and long‑term value. Whether undertaking a minor repair or a larger renovation, the emphasis remains on delivering functional improvements that are both cost‑effective and durable, with an eye toward safety and regulatory compliance.
